Kakao: The android member of Taurus' team in DBZ movie 3, Kakao first battles Yamcha and rather easily beats him. He is eventually killed by Goku.

Kaichyou Oyaku: Family of giant worm-like creatures that Vegeta and Goku encounter while searching for Gohan and the others in Buu's body, the Kaichyou Oyaku had incredibly powerful exoskeletons since the head of the family took ki blasts from both Goku and Vegeta without even being stunned. When it is discovered that they aren't enemies Goku and Vegeta leave.

Kaizoku Robo: A giant robot constructed by pirates to guard their treasure, Kaizoku Robo is beaten easily by Goku. His main weapons are the machine gun he has for an arm, which never runs out of ammo, and a flame thrower.

Kame/Kamesama(God): Kamesama is the god of the Earth. He tried to become God of the Earth a long time ago, but was denied because of the evil within him. To resolve this problem, Kamesama split himself into two beings, one good and one evil. The result of the evil was Piccolo Daimoa, to whom he had a apiritual link - meaning that if one dies, the other one dies also. When Goku killed Piccolo Daimoa, Kamesama was able to survive due to his offspring, the Piccolo of DBZ. He is also the creator of the dragon balls, which like Piccolo, die if either of them dies.

Kanassajins: People whom Bardock and his group are attacking in the beginning of the Bardock story, the Kanassajins have powerful psychic abilities and knew that the Saiyans were going to kill them.

Kargo: Child Namekseijin, Kargo was killed when Dodoria attacked Dende and Muuri's village.

Karin: Grower of the sezu beans and protector of the sacred water, Karin lives in a tower a little below Kame's Palace. He is very wise and intelligent, and helps Goku when fighting Tao Pai. He is seen very little in DBZ, but always pulls through to have sezu beans grown.

Karinto: Met by Goku during his training with Mr. Popo, Karinto was the one that Goku was seeking to teach him "Quiet like the Sky".

Kenpau Ka: Street fighter that offers 100,000 zeni to anyone that can beat him. Kenpau Ka fights Goku and is beaten easily. Goku uses the money to find Bulma's house.

Kibit/Kibito: None of his past is revealed, but he is the assistant of Kaioshin. He is killed by Dabura, but is resurrected when Shenron is summoned by Bulma after Vegeta killed many spectators of the Tenkaichi Budoukai. Hie special ability is souki idou, instantaneous movement, to any lower planet and to Kaioshin's world. He eventually fuses with KaioShin to demonstrate the power of the pateras.

Kid Katsu: Contender in the GT Tenkaichi Budoukai, Kid Katsu made it to the semi-finals.

Killer: Killer was a tall black man who competed in the 25th Tenkaichi Budoukai. He makes it to the free for all match between Android 18, Jewel, Mr. Satan, and Mighty Mask(Trunks and Goten). Because Mighty Mask wanted to fight 18, he knocked Killer out of the ring immediately.

King Cold: Father of Frieza and Cooler, King Cold looks kind of like Frieza's second form except he wears battle armor. He is killed by Mirai No Trunks in our timeline by getting blasted near the heart, then completely blasted. He makes about two more appearences in the Z timeline, one after Goku dies in the Cell saga, and during the Buu/Goku fight.

King Don Kea: King of the planet Imegga, Don Kea was a ruthless and greedy leader. He was dethrowned when facing Goku and the others, his bodyguard Ledgic is beaten, and leaves Don Kea to take care of Goku himself. Not being very strong, he could do nothing against them and gives up.

King Gurumesu: Appearing in Dragon Ball movie 1, King Gurumesu is a normal person who became corrupt when he found rubies that made him have an insatiable hunger.

King Yama/Lord Enma: The overseer of hades, Lord Enma decided whether a soul would go to heaven or hell. He is very short tempered, and loses it very often in the series.

King Kai/North KaioSama: God of the northern galaxy, King Kai lives of a small planet with his friends Bubbles and Gregory. When the Saiyans were on their way to Earth, Goku ventured Snake Way to seek training from him, since he was thought to be the greatest martial artist of the northern galaxy. He isn't very serious at all and constantly makes bad jokes. When his planet is destroyed by Cell, he and Goku travel to Dai Kaiosama's world to visit old friends and meet strong fighters.

King Kuresu: Father of Princess Miisa, King Kuresu's kingdom was constantly attacked by demons. When Goku arrives, he saved the kingdom by sealing all the demons in hell, saving Princess Miisa.

King Moai: Dictating ruler of Planet Arlia, King Moai was killed by Vegeta after trying to plea for his life.

King Vegeta: King Vegeta is the father of the proud Prince Vegeta. Unlike most Saiyan fathers, he decided to keep his son with him rather than send him to a planet to conquer. Having a large hatred for the tyrant Frieza, he gathers all the elites to go kill him when Frieza attempts to destroy Planet Vegeta. Though very strong, he is easily killed by Frieza with only two hits. After he died, Frieza kills the other elites that came without any difficulty.

Kinkaku: Kinkaku was a thug whom Goku meets when he's traveling around the world. Kinkaku and his brother, Ginkaku, would terrorize the people of a mountain village and force them to give them food once a month. Kinkaku's main weapon was a man-eating gourd that sucks people in and turns them into sake.

Kinoni Sarada: Appearing in the Dr. Slump/Dragon Ball crossover, Kinoni rode around on a tricycle. He had a kind of light hearted and strange personality.

Kirano: Participant of the Tenkaichi Budoukai at the end of DBZ, Kiranowas to face Captain Chicken.

Kishime: Bio warior in DBZ movie 2, Kishime's main attack was the use of electric tentacles which he had attached to his arms. He is killed by Goku.

Kokuou: King of the Earth, as it seemed, Kokuou didn't hold much of a role in any of the three series, though he did care about his people and was a popular ruler. When attacked by the Piccolo Daimoa, he was forced to renounce his throne. After Goku killed Piccolo, he became King once more.

Konkichi: Little fox-like kid whom Goku encounters on his trip around the world, Konkichi is a thief, but only steals to survive. Because Goku saved his life, he treated Goku like a king.

Kouryu: Ten year old competitor in the 25th Tenkaichi Budoukai Children's Division.

Krillin: Krillin is a monk who trained with Kamesennin and Chibi Son Goku. He has no nose, no hair until later in the series. Krillin is the strongest human, but never as strong as a Saiyan, let alone a Super Saiyan. He marries Android 18 later in the series and has a daughter named Marron. He plays an important role in the series, as he was killed by Frieza, causing Goku to become a Super Saiyan for the first time.

Kui: Kui went to Planet Nameksei to face Vegeta after he went in search of the dragon balls. He is killed pretty easily by Vegeta after he begged for his life.

Kurikinton Soramame: Appearing in the Dr. Slump/Dragon Ball crossover, Kurikinton was a barber.

Lanfan: Lanfan fought against Namu in the 21st Tenkaichi Budoukai. She used her sexuality to distract her opponent, leaving him open to attacks. When Namu remembered his mission to get water for his village, he closed his eyes and knocked out Lanfan.

Ledgic: First enemy encountered in Dragon Ball GT, Ledgic is the body guard of King Don Kea, and the reason he was still in power. When faced against Goku, he beats on him pretty badly, until Goku goes Super Saiyan. Impressed with Goku's superior strength, he stops fighting and leaves the warriors in peace.

Lenne: Forced to marry Zunama, Lenne wore a dragon ball in her hair, and in exchange for taking care of Zunama for her, Goku and the others would recieve the dragon ball. Trying to trick Zunama, Trunks dressed up like Lenne to infiltrate Zunama's lair, where he would cut off his antennas.

Leon: Gigantic lion-like monster, Leon was Mutchy-Motchy's pet and would destroy anything if Mutchy couldn't take care of the problem himself. It was easily beaten when Goku fired a ki blast into the wall, causing a huge boulder to crush Leon.

Lucifer: Vampire-like demon in DB movie 2, Lucifer attempts to destroy the sun to create a world of absolute darkness. When he is about to fire the laser cannon at the sun, Goku's kamehamaha moves the cannon to a position so the laser fires directly at Lucifer, killing him.

Lude monster: The creation of Dr. Myuu, the monster, was the idol that was said to be god. In order for it to receive full power, energy from people needed to be absorbed. It had three stages of power, and was revived at stage two due to Goku and Trunks defeating Mutchy. In order to reach level three to beat Goku and Trunks, Lude changed Doll-Tucky into a doll and threw him andn Pan into the monster for it to gain the energy required. He was finally defeated when Goku and Pan hit its cell at the same time, freeing all who were absorbed.

Lunch: Possesing no ki power, Lunch has the ability to transform from a good-hearted young girl into a machine gun wielding gangster. During the training of Goku and Krillin by Muten Roshi, she was a cook. She is seen rarely in DBZ and has a thing for Tenshinhan. After Tenshinhan dies in battle with Nappa, she is seen getting drunk in a bar. (The scene was cut from the American versions.)
